    It's not exactly what you were asking for, but you could put a link in your sig to a search for threads you have started. In your case, the URL would be: http://www.dgrin.com/search.php?do=finduser&u=6168&starteronly=1 There's probably a parameter you could add to limit the search to the X most recent results, but I'd have to look that up.

    I rather doubt it would accomplish much, though, as people would have to click twice to actually get to a thread, and that's just so much work. mwink.gif
